Subject: Encoding detection fix rolling out tonight

Team — the Textgate update improving encoding detection for uploaded text files ships at 22:00. Files previously misread as Latin-1 will now be sniffed with the new heuristic; expect a brief spike in re-processing jobs. If detection errors climb, roll back via the standard channel. The deployed build carries the token shown below.

pipeline stamp: htk31_f769b577b3028a4e9958e5bb8d1259a

Minutes — Management Meeting, Office Closure

Present: Halden, Virez, and finance leads. The Brencastle satellite office will close at quarter-end. Lease exit costs were reviewed and accepted; staff will transfer to the Moorlight site or work remotely. Finance to model severance and relocation provisions by next Tuesday. Facilities will coordinate asset disposal. The confidential note on forward plans is appended directly below.

management briefing: Project Ulavan slips by two quarters because of the staffing delay.

## Migration Step 4: Fix currency rounding

KestrelPay v3 rounded converted amounts per line item, then summed. Totals drifted by a cent or two on multi-item invoices. v4 sums in minor units first, converts once, rounds last. Before cutting over, drain the reconciliation queue — mixed-mode invoices will fail validation otherwise. If alerts fire mid-migration, do not roll back; set the compatibility flag and re-run the batch. Apply the conversion service settings exactly as given. The required values follow.

deployment values, yadup-kadug:
[sorys]
port = 5672
team = noveth
host = sorys.orvexcorp.example
region = south-4
access_code = ac_deddc1
timeout_ms = 1500

# Session Handling — Resolver Flakiness (Nightjar Gateway)

The Nightjar gateway occasionally fails to resolve the internal auth host, causing premature session invalidation. We now cache resolved addresses for 60 seconds and retry resolution twice with jitter before tearing down a session. Security note: cached entries are scoped per-tenant and cleared on credential rotation, so stale resolution cannot cross tenant boundaries. Reviewers wanting to reproduce the failure in the Corbel sandbox should authenticate with the token below.

session JWT of yawep-yawep = eyJhbGciOiJIUzI1NiIsInR5cCI6IkpXVCJ9.eyJzdWIiOiI3pWF3_In0.aXYsHiog